AU03 ZSX is a 2003 Vauxhall Astravan in Silver with a 1,700c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 29 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.4%.
Across all 2003 Vauxhall Astravan models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.6% with a typical mileage of 108,331 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Astravan f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 35,295 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AU03 ZSX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Astravan typ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 23 years old, this Vauxhall Astravan is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
